Holdings Description:SUMMARY: The Ernst Mayr Library collects works at the graduate research level in zoology, animal behavior, biodiversity, bioinformatics, biological oceanography, cell biology, comparative biology, conservation biology, developmental biology, ecology, evolution, genetics, molecular biology, natural history, neurobiology, and paleontology. Special Collections include older natural history volumes and the archives of the Museum of Comparative Zoology. MATERIALS NOT HELD:In general, the following kinds of works will not be found, or not in significant quantities: agriculture; fisheries biology; and geology (other than paleontology). SIZE: 109,000 monographs; 165,000 serial volumes; 2,223 currently received serial titles. EXPANDED COLLECTION DESCRIPTION: The Ernst Mayr Library collects works in the following fields: systematic zoology; general zoology (comparative anatomy and physiology); organismal biology; biodiversity; conservation biology; ecology; evolutionary biology; marine biology; biological oceanography; ethology; paleontology. In addition, the library has an extensive early natural history collection, as well as Special Collections consisting of many old and rare volumes including the papers of Louis Agassiz and others associated with the Museum. The archives of the MCZ are also here.
